How much do hospitality development j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 13, 2026, the average yearly pay for hospitality development in Chicago, IL is $79,773.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$60,300.00 and $93,200.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in hospitality development?

To thrive in Hospitality Development, you need expertise in real estate, project management, and hospitality industry trends, often supported by a relevant degree and experience in property development or hotel management. Familiarity with financial analysis software, property management systems, and project planning tools is highly valuable. Strong negotiation, interpersonal, and leadership skills help drive successful collaborations with stakeholders and teams. These skills are crucial for identifying profitable opportunities, ensuring projects are delivered on time and within budget, and maintaining high standards in hospitality environments.

What are some common challenges faced in hospitality development projects, and how can professionals in this role effectively address them?

Professionals in hospitality development often encounter challenges such as managing complex stakeholder interests, adhering to tight project timelines, and navigating regulatory requirements. Successfully addressing these issues requires strong project management skills, effective communication with investors, architects, and local authorities, and an in-depth understanding of market trends. Proactive risk assessment and fostering collaborative relationships across teams can help ensure projects stay on track and meet quality standards. Staying updated on industry best practices and local regulations also plays a crucial role in overcoming these challenges.

What is the difference between Hospitality Development vs Hospitality Management?

AspectHospitality DevelopmentHospitality Management
Primary FocusPlanning, designing, and launching new hospitality projectsOverseeing daily operations of existing hospitality properties
Required CredentialsBusiness, hospitality, or real estate degrees; project management certificationsHospitality or hotel management degrees; operational certifications
Work EnvironmentOffice settings, site visits, project meetingsHotel or resort properties, staff management
Employer & Industry UsageReal estate developers, hotel chains, consulting firmsHotels, resorts, hospitality companies

Hospitality Development focuses on creating and launching new hospitality projects, involving planning and design. Hospitality Management centers on running and maintaining existing properties, ensuring smooth daily operations. While both roles require hospitality knowledge, their core responsibilities and work environments differ significantly.
